Tax Relief for American Families and Workers Act of 2024
Long title
To make improvements to the child tax credit, to provide tax incentives to promote economic growth, to provide special rules for the taxation of certain residents of Taiwan with income from sources within the United States, to provide tax relief with respect to certain Federal disasters, to make improvements to the low-income housing tax credit, and for other purposes.
Enacted by
the 118th United States Congress
Legislative history
Introduced in the House of Representatives as H.R. 7024 by Jason Smith (R–TX) on January 17, 2024
Committee consideration by House Ways and Means
Passed the House on January 31, 2024 (357-70)
The Tax Relief forAmerican Families and Workers Act of 2024 is a tax bill in the 118th United States Congress (H.R. 7024) that would amend portions of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986. The bill was approved by the House of Representatives on January 31, 2024, by a bipartisan vote 357–70.[1]
